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Low Carb Light Beer vs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t:
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t contain more Vitamin B1, more Vitamin B2, more Vitamin B3, more Vitamin B6, more Vitamin B9, more Vitamin C and more Vitamin K than Low Carb Light Beer.
Both Low Carb Light Beer as well as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in D and Vitamin E in 100 g.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Low Carb Light Beer vs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t:
Low Carb Light Beer has 1.4 times more Water than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t.
While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t contain 3.3 times more Calcium, 38.5 times more Copper, more Iron, 5.3 times more Magnesium, 31.4 times more Manganese, 10.1 times more Phosphorus, 22.4 times more Potassium, 116.3 times more Sodium and 34 times more Zinc than Low Carb Light Beer.
Both Low Carb Light Beer as well as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t have insufficient amounts of Selenium in 100 g.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t contain 5.4 times more Energy, more Fat, more Saturated Fat, more Omega 3, more Omega 6, 32.8 times more Carbohydrate, more Fiber and 13.8 times more Protein than Low Carb Light Beer.
Both Low Carb Light Beer as well as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t have insufficient amounts of Cholesterol, Fructose, Glucose and Sucrose in 100 g.
